Beyond aesthetics, windows in wall can also improve the energy efficiency of a building. By strategically placing windows to capture natural light and promote cross-ventilation, you can reduce the reliance on artificial lighting and cooling systems, thereby lowering energy costs and minimizing your carbon footprint. With energy-efficient glazing options and proper insulation, windows in wall can help regulate indoor temperatures and create a more comfortable living environment year-round.
